Transaction 7a1c5aa60da92b059abaf693571fc9d7529289caa00668383c01c5f41da3cfec
1 Input
1 Outputs
- 7a1c5aa60da92b059abaf693571fc9d7529289caa00668383c01c5f41da3cfec:0
value 1549000000
address 1NqGpLhzr7BDJ12DtnfdkaydP64XwSqapG